+/* Subtract COUNT and FREQUENCY from the basic block and it's
+ outgoing edge. */
+static void
+decrease_profile (basic_block bb, gcov_type count, int frequency)
+{
+ edge e;
+ bb->count -= count;
+ if (bb->count < 0)
+ bb->count = 0;
+ bb->frequency -= frequency;
+ if (bb->frequency < 0)
+ bb->frequency = 0;
+ if (!single_succ_p (bb))
+ {
+ gcc_assert (!EDGE_COUNT (bb->succs));
+ return;
+ }
+ e = single_succ_edge (bb);
+ e->count -= count;
+ if (e->count < 0)
+ e->count = 0;
+}
